Executive summary

To claim efficacy for a condition like tinnitus, a dietary supplement must navigate a legal and evidentiary minefield: manufacturers may not lawfully market a supplement as preventing or treating a disease and instead must rely on narrow "structure/function" or qualified claims backed by adequate scientific substantiation and regulatory notifications (DSHEA/FDA rules). The scientific bar for credible efficacy is the same rigorous clinical evidence that supports medical claims—well‑designed, placebo‑controlled trials and a contextual body of evidence—yet no dietary supplement has FDA approval for tinnitus and major clinical guidelines advise against recommending supplements for persistent tinnitus [1] [2] [3].

1. Regulatory framing: supplements are foods, not approved drugs

Under U.S. law dietary supplements are regulated as a category of food rather than drugs, which means they cannot be marketed with claims to diagnose, cure, mitigate, prevent, or treat a disease without triggering drug regulation; such disease claims would subject the product to drug standards and approvals that few supplements meet [1] [4]. The FDA explicitly regulates labeling and requires manufacturers to notify the agency for certain structure/function claims under section 403(r) and to substantiate claims so they are truthful and not misleading [5] [2].

2. What claim language is legally allowed—and what it requires

Manufacturers can make structure/function claims (for example, "supports auditory function") but not disease treatment claims, and must submit notifications to FDA within 30 days of marketing certain labels; the agency and FTC expect claims to be scientifically substantiated and non‑misleading [6] [5] [2]. For stronger health claims that imply a relationship to a disease, FDA requires either formal petition processes, authoritative statements, or "significant scientific agreement," depending on the category of claim—an evidentiary threshold that effectively demands robust human clinical data [7] [8].

3. The scientific standard: randomized, controlled, reproducible evidence

To credibly claim efficacy for a symptom like tinnitus, manufacturers need well‑designed clinical trials—typically randomized, double‑blind, placebo‑controlled studies—and a consistent body of evidence showing meaningful benefit over placebo and acceptable safety; FDA guidance tells industry to ensure support is scientifically sound and adequate in the context of surrounding evidence [2] [9]. Clinical guidelines and specialty societies review that evidence: major otolaryngology guidance and reviews conclude that studied supplements such as ginkgo biloba, melatonin, zinc, and others have not demonstrated reliable benefit for persistent tinnitus and therefore are not recommended [3] [10] [11].

4. Practical and methodological pitfalls specific to supplements

Beyond trial design, supplements face endemic problems that weaken efficacy claims: variable ingredient amounts between batches, unlisted adulterants found by FDA in some products, and limited safety/interaction data—facts that investigators and regulators repeatedly flag as reasons to distrust positive small trials unless replicated and standardized [3] [1]. Even where preliminary studies suggest possible mechanisms or subgroup benefits (for example, zinc in deficient patients or exploratory magnesium data), those findings require confirmatory trials before they justify treatment claims [9] [12].

5. Enforcement, marketing incentives, and the reality of misinformation

Regulation is enforced by a mix of FDA oversight on labeling and manufacturing, and FTC action against deceptive advertising; both agencies expect substantiation but enforcement is reactive and resource‑limited, creating incentives for marketers to exploit ambiguous "supports" language and social media hype to sell products—an industry dynamic documented in fact checks and regulatory reports [2] [1] [11]. Consumers should note that no dietary supplement is FDA‑approved to treat tinnitus, despite frequent promotional claims and persistent online narratives that a single pill is a cure [3] [13].

6. Bottom line for credible efficacy claims

A lawful, credible efficacy claim for tinnitus would require avoiding disease language, filing the appropriate structure/function notification, and resting the claim on rigorous, reproducible clinical evidence consistent with FDA/FTC guidance; absent that combination, both regulators and clinical experts treat supplement claims for tinnitus with skepticism and recommend established therapies and evidence‑based management instead [5] [2] [3].
